Introduction 

Research Intelligence Services Training Course is designed to enhance research capabilities, intelligence analysis, knowledge management, and strategic decision-making skills within modern organizations. The course focuses on emerging research intelligence methodologies, competitive intelligence, data-driven insights, digital research tools, and advanced information analysis techniques that support organizational growth and innovation. Participants gain practical expertise in collecting, evaluating, analyzing, and transforming complex information into actionable intelligence for policy development, business strategy, academic advancement, and operational excellence. 

In today’s rapidly evolving information environment, organizations require professionals who can manage large volumes of data, identify emerging trends, conduct intelligence assessments, and support evidence-based decision-making. This training integrates research analytics, open-source intelligence (OSINT), information governance, market intelligence, and technology-enabled research practices to improve institutional performance. Through global case studies, interactive exercises, and practical applications, participants develop the skills required to deliver high-quality research intelligence services across diverse sectors.
